  7. Seaview (Galloway, New Jersey) -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Seaview_(Galloway,_New_Jersey)

    The golf club dates from 1914, when public utility magnate Clarence H. Geist founded the Seaview Country Club. The original golf course, known today as the Bay Course, was partially designed by Hugh Wilson (who also designed the two courses at Merion Golf Club). In 1915, Donald Ross completed the course by adding the sand bunkers. [6]
